Acerca de este artículo

  • Rastreador de fitness con alto confort en el diseño delgado
  • Grabación de la pasos, cálculo de distancia, consumo de calorías y dormitorio análisis y move iqtm – Tiempo de detección automática de actividades como caminar, correr, natación y ciclismo
  • Personalizable con display diseños individuales, temas y colores individuales textos y find My Phone de función y la información meteorológica

I've been considering getting a fitness watch for a while.What's put me of, and thousands of others I suspect, has been the need to charge it every few days, the variety & complexity of features - and the cost.Vívofit 4 is the complete opposite. The inbuilt replaceable battery will keep the device running for a year or more.Secondly, it's easy to use with a good range of nice basic features that will satisfy all but the real fitness experts. Then again, modern smart phones have a lot of fitness features baked in anyway. So I see little point in duplicating these on a smart watch.Vívofit 4 is comfortable, waterproof, has a smart discreet design with a colour screen & a back light.And, price wise, it's well under £100!Feature wise, it does a surprising amount. It will auto detect a number of activities, monitor sleep, tell you to move if you're being idle too long & help you to set activity goals. It'll even find your phone!The supporting Garmin Connect app is like the watch - well designed & intuitive. I also use Health Sync which enables me to sync the Vívofit data with Google Fit where, separately, I record things like heart rate, BP & weight.So, if you're looking for a good quality, easy to use, no need to charge & well designed watch with a good range of basic features, I would strongly recommend you take a look at the Vívofit 4.

The 1 year battery life is what brought me to the Vivofit4 after my Fitbit eventually died after long term hard use. It counts steps (main purpose) and monitors Sleep ( secondary purpose). Steps counting is a bit 'jumpy' with wild numbers indicated on the device until eventually settling. REM has not appeared at all. Date format on the device stubbornly refuses to change from Month/Day to day/month. Disappointed. It will be returned.
